Whoa, how is the liquid BG turning into snot balls? I ordered some 3 liters and have yet to see this happen. Can you describe to me more what you mean?
Kristen |
I think I figured out the problem. I took a 3 day trip and decided not to take the whole pump bottle of BG with me so I took the pump off to pour some BG in a small bottle. NO "snot" consistancy. I put the pump back on and pumped some out and the "snot" was back. So........I took it all out and am now using a flip top bottle. Something to do with my pump. ![Rolling Eyes](images/smiles/rolleyes.gif) |
